Lohner spent his Freshman and Sophomore years of high school at Flower Mound High School in Texas, before transferring to Wasatch Academy in Utah to finish his high school career. Lohner announced he is transferring to Baylor, which will begin competing against BYU in the Big 12 Conference in 2023. Lohner averaged seven points and 6.4 rebounds per game last season, and hes a Dallas, Texas native, so hes coming closer to home, as Waco is about a 90-minute drive.
